Captain Walter Auble was shot and killed by a burglary suspect.
He and another captain were investigating two suspects involved in robberies and burglaries and learned they were about to commit another crime. They located the suspects at 9th and Grand Avenue.
The other captain took one suspect into custody but the second man produced a revolver and shot Captain Auble several times. The man who shot Captain Auble committed suicide by swallowing poison as other officers and citizens surrounded him.
Captain Auble was taken to the police receiving hospital where he succumbed to his wounds.
Captain Auble was survived by his wife, two daughters, and son.
